Abelardo Gil-Fournier Explores Technical Image and Atmosphere at Galería Ángeles Baños

exhibition · 2026-06-22

Abelardo Gil-Fournier showcases 'El signo y la calima' at Galería Ángeles Baños in Badajoz, presenting two pieces that investigate the interplay of image as both a technical and atmospheric phenomenon. The series 'Dunas / Micrografías' draws upon the shifting dune Råbjerg Mile in Denmark to depict themes of instability and motion, linking modern digital visuals to 19th-century landscape art. Layered fragments from these paintings create a visual experience shaped by noise and climate influences. Additionally, 'Adivinación artificial' explores the relationship between computation and animal behavior, featuring three panels that reinterpret ornithomancy texts through bird ring measurements. This exhibition underscores the relationships between atmosphere, information, and interpretation. The 'Dunas / Micrografías' series received support from the 2024 Leonardo Grant by the BBVA Foundation.
